ABSTRACT

Objective To explore the impact of paricalcitol(Pal)on the oxidative stress-induced tight junction dam-age of mouse hepatocytes and its mechanism.Methods A model of cholestatic liver injury was created by routine bile duct ligation.The mice were randomly divided into control group(control),model group(BDL)and treatment group(BDL+Pal).HE staining microscopy was used to observe the morphological changes of liver tissues.The human hepa-toma cell line HepG2 was cultured and divided into blank group,model group(400 μmol/L H2O2)and treatment group(400 μmol/L H2O2+20 nmol/L Pal).Western blot was used to examine the level of tight junction protein 1(ZO-1),occludin,phosphorylated p65(p-p65),phosphorylated ERK(p-ERK)and phosphorylated myosin II regulated light chain(p-MLC)protein were checked in each group.Results Compared with the control group,the level of p-p65,p-ERK and p-MLC in the model group was significantly increased(P<0.000 1 or P<0.01 or P<0.001).The protein expression of ZO-1 and occludin was significantly decreased(P<0.01).HE staining mi-croscopy showed an increased hepatocyte necrosis and inflammatory cell infiltration.In contrast,the above levels in the treatment group showed an opposite trend relative to the model group.Conclusions Pal is able to alleviate the damage of hepatocyte tight junctions by inhibiting oxidative stress in cholestatic mice and HepG2 cells.Its mecha-nism is potentially related to the inhibition of reactive oxygen species and NF-κB/p65 and ERK signaling pathways.

ABSTRACT

Objective To investigate the effects of polydatin(PD)on the proliferation and apoptosis of pulmonary artery smooth muscle cells(PASMCs)in hypoxic pulmonary hypertension(HPH)neonatal rats,and its mechanism of action.Methods Neonatal rats were randomly separated into six groups:control group,model group,low dose PD group,medium dose PD group,high dose PD group,and high dose PD+Hippo pathway inhibitor(high dose PD+XMU-MP-1)group,with 10 rats in each group.After 2 weeks of hypoxia treatment,the right ventricular systolic blood pressure(RVSP)and right ventricular hypertro-phy index(RVHI)of rats in each group were measured.Hematoxylin-eosin(HE)staining was applied to observe pathological changes in lung tissue,and the percentage of pulmonary artery wall thickness to total thickness(WT)and the percentage of wall area to total area(WA)were calculated.Neonatal rat PASMCs were separated from each group,which were divided into NC group,hypoxia group,low dose PD group,medium dose PD group,high dose PD group,and high dose PD+XMU-MP-1 group.Cell counting kit 8(CCK-8)and 5-ethynyl-2'-deoxyuridine(EdU)were applied to detect cell proliferation.Flow cytometry was applied to detect cell apoptosis.Western blot was applied to detect the expression of Yes-associated protein 1(YAP1),tran-scriptional coactivator with PDZ-binding motif(TAZ),mammalian sterile 20-like kinase 1(MST1),B-cell lymphoma 2(Bcl-2),and Bcl-2 associated protein(Bax)in lung tissue and PASMCs.Results Compared with the control group,the pulmonary artery wall in the model group was significantly thickened,lumen was narrowed,and protein expressions of RVSP,RVHI,WT%,WA%,YAP1,MST1 and TAZ were significantly increased(all P<0.05).Compared with the model group,pulmonary artery thickening and lumen enlargement were observed in the low,medium and high dose PD groups,and the protein expressions of RVSP,RVHI,WT%,WA%,YAP1,MST1 and TAZ were significantly decreased,which showed a dose-dependent relationship(all P<0.05).The effect could be reversed by XMU-MP-1.Compared with the NC group,the cell A450nm value,EdU positive rate,the protein expression of YAP1,MST1,TAZ and Bcl-2 in the hydropoxia group were significantly increased.The apoptosis rate and the expression of Bax protein were obviously reduced(all P<0.05).Compared with the hypoxia group,the cell A450nm value,EdU positive rate,the protein expression of YAP1,MST1,TAZ and Bcl-2 in the low,medium and high dose PD groups were obviously reduced.The apoptosis rate and the expression of Bax were significantly increased,which showed a dose-depend-ent relationship(all P<0.05).The effect could be reversed by XMU-MP-1.Conclusion PD may inhibit the proliferation of PASMCs in HPH neonatal rats and promote apoptosis by inhibiting YAP1/TAZ signaling pathway.

ABSTRACT

Objective:To investigate the relationship between the visceral adiposity index(VAI) and cognitive decline.Methods:A cross-sectional study was conducted.Between October 2020 and March 2023, 483 elderly residents living in communities in Hefei were recruited and divided into four groups based on VAI scores, Q1(VAI ≤ 1.14), Q2(VAI>1.15 and ≤1.85), Q3(VAI>1.86 and ≤2.81) and Q4(VAI>2.82).General cognitive function was assessed by(MMSE)and(MoCA).Attention and working memory were tested by forward and backward digit span tasks.Logistic regression was utilized to analyze the relationship between different VAI scores and insulin resistance.The correlation between different VAI scores and cognitive function domains was analyzed by partial correlation.Results:The values of BMI, fasting plasma glucose, fasting insulin, HbA1c, high-sensitivity C-reactive protein, HOMA-IR and HOMA-β increased with increasing VAI scores(all P<0.01).VAI was significantly correlated with insulin sensitivity after adjusting for confounding factors including sex.The risk of insulin resistance in Q4 was 7.40 times that in Q1( OR=7.40, 95% CI: 4.30-12.74, P<0.05).In addition, the correlation coefficients between VAI and forward digital span and between VAI and backward digital span were -0.116 and -0.105, respectively(both P<0.05), but there was no correlation between VAI and MMSE or MoCA. Conclusions:VAI is closely related to insulin resistance and also associated with early cognitive decline in elderly people with visceral obesity.

ABSTRACT

Objective:To evaluate the effect of goal-directed fluid therapy (GDFT) on postoperative acute kidney injury (AKI) in elderly patients undergoing long-time abdominal surgery.Methods:The medical records from elderly patients of both sexes, aged ≥ 65 yr, with a duration of operation ≥ 8 h and American Society of Anesthesiologists Physical Status classification Ⅱ or Ⅲ, undergoing elective first abdominal surgery for gastrointestinal tumors at the Shanxi Provincial People′s Hospital from October 1, 2016 to June 30, 2022, were collected from the electronic medical record database. Patients were divided into conventional fluid therapy group (group C) and GDFT group (group G) according to whether GDFT was employed during operation. In group C, blood pressure was maintained ≥90/60 mmHg or mean arterial pressure≥65 mmHg, and urine output more than 30 ml/h. In group G, the stroke volume variation was maintained ≤13%, and cardiac index ≥2.5 L·min -1·m -2. The patient general characteristics, requirement for fluid, urine output, blood loss, requirement for vasoactive agents and abdominal hyperthermic perfusion, and operation time were recorded during operation. The development of AKI within 72 h after operation and development of other complications (pneumonia, anastomotic leakage, surgical site infection, septic shock, arrhythmia) after operation were recorded. The length of hospital stay and 30-day mortality after operation were recorded. Results:A total of 125 patients were included in this study, with 41 patients in group C and 84 patients in group G. Postoperative AKI occurred in 19 patients, with an incidence of 15.2%. Compared with group C, the requirement for colloid, total volume of fluid infused and urine volume were significantly decreased during operation, the requirement for vasoactive agents was increased during operation ( P<0.05), the risk of postoperative AKI was reduced ( OR=0.23, P<0.05), and no significant change was found in the incidence of other postoperative complications, 30-day mortality, and length of hospital stay in group G ( P>0.05). Conclusions:GDFT can reduce the risk of AKI in the elderly patients undergoing long-time abdominal surgery.

ABSTRACT

Objective@#The association between school bullying and attention deficit hyperactivity disorder (ADHD) symptoms among students in primary schools and the moderating role of gender was explored to provide scientific evidence for the prevention and control of school bullying.@*Methods@#A total of 4 764 students from 2 primary schools in Wuhan were selected using the convenience sampling method in March 2023. The Olweus Bully/Victim Questionnaire and Strengths and Difficulties Questionnaire were used. A Pearson χ 2 test was used to compare differences in school bullying rates among children with and without ADHD symptoms. Pearson correlation analysis and Process 3.3 were used to analyse the association between ADHD symptoms, and school bullying behaviour and the moderating role of gender.@*Results@#The reported rate of bullying victims in primary schools was 24.2% and the rate of bullying perpetration was 3.8%. The rate of ADHD symptom detection among primary school students was 5.9%. ADHD symptoms were positively associated with bullying and bullying victim behaviour ( r =0.16, 0.27, P <0.01). Specifically, the association between ADHD symptoms and bullying behavior tended to be stronger among boys than girls ( β boy =0.17, t =11.13; β girl =0.07, t =4.11, P <0.01).@*Conclusions@#ADHD symptoms are an important factor influencing school bullying behaviors in students, and gender moderates the association. In the process of preventing and controlling school bullying, ADHD symptoms and gender differences should be emphasized and comprehensive interventions should be implemented.

ABSTRACT

Objective:To evaluate the effect of continuous positive airway pressure (CPAP) ventilation during induction of anesthesia on perioperative atelectasis and oxygenation in elderly patients.Methods:Forty-six elderly patients of either sex, aged 65-80 yr, of American Society of Anesthesiologists Physical Status classification Ⅱ or Ⅲ, undergoing elective cerebrovascular intervention surgery under general anesthesia, were divided into 2 groups ( n=23 each) according to the random number table method: control group (group C) and CPAP ventilation group (group CPAP). During induction of anesthesia, CPAP was set at 5 cmH 2O during spontaneous breathing, and PEEP was set at 5 cmH 2O when spontaneous breathing disappeared, and the ventilation mode was changed to pressure-controlled ventilation (PCV) mode in group CPAP. CPAP was not set, and PEEP was set at 0 cmH 2O for PCV when spontaneous breathing disappeared in group C. During anesthesia maintenance, PCV-volume guaranteed mode was used in both groups, and PEEP was set at 5 cmH 2O. Whole lung CT scanning was performed immediately after radial artery catheterization (T 0), at 1 min after endotracheal intubation (T 1), and before tracheal extubation (T 2) at the end of operation to calculate the percentage of atelectasis area at 1 cm above the right diaphragm. At T 0, T 1, T 2 and 30 min after entering postanesthesia care unit (T 3), blood samples from the radial artery were taken to record PaO 2 and PaCO 2 and calculate the oxygenation index (OI). Results:Compared with the baseline at T 0, the percentage of atelectasis area was significantly increased at T 1 and T 2 in two groups ( P<0.05); PaO 2 was significantly increased at T 1 and T 2 and decreased to T 0 level at T 3, OI was decreased at T 1 and T 2 and increased to T 0 level at T 3 in two groups ( P<0.05). Compared with group C, the percentage of atelectasis area was significantly decreased and PaO 2 and OI were increased at T 1 and T 2 in group CPAP ( P<0.05). There was no significant difference in PaCO 2 at each time point between the two groups ( P>0.05). Conclusions:CPAP ventilation during induction of anesthesia can reduce the development of perioperative atelectasis and improve the oxygenation in elderly patients.

ABSTRACT

Objective:To evaluate the effect of continuous positive airway pressure(CPAP) ventilation strategy during induction of general anesthesia on atelectasis after induction in obese patients.Methods:A total of 86 patients, aged 30-60 yr, with body mass index of 28-35 kg/m 2, of American Society of Anesthesiologists Physical Status classification Ⅱor Ⅲ, scheduled for elective cerebrovascular intervention under general anesthesia, were divided into 2 groups ( n=43 each) using a random number table method: CPAP group (group C) and routine group (group R). Group C received CPAP 5 cmH 2O-assisted ventilation after preoxygenation for spontaneous breathing and disappearance of spontaneous breathing. Chest CT scan and arterial blood gas analysis were performed after entering the operating room (T 1) and 5 min after endotracheal intubation (T 2) to calculate the percentage of atelectasis area and to record PaO 2. Dynamic lung compliance and plateau pressure were recorded at T 2. Mean minute ventilation under controlled breathing, P ETCO 2, and use of vasoactive drugs during induction were recorded. The occurrence of reflux and aspiration during mask ventilation was recorded. The development of pulmonary complications within 3 days after operation was recorded. Results:Compared with group R, the percentage of atelectasis area at T 2 was significantly decreased, PaO 2, dynamic lung compliance and plateau pressure were increased ( P<0.05), and no significant change was found in mean minute ventilation, P ETCO 2, requirement for vasoactive drugs and incidence of pulmonary complications in group C ( P>0.05). No reflux or aspiration was observed during mask ventilation. Conclusions:CPAP (5 cmH 2O) strategy during anesthesia induction can reduce the degree of atelectasis after induction in obese patients.

ABSTRACT

Objective:To summarize the features of stenosis or premature closure of fetal ductus arteriosus and to investigate the perinatal management strategies.Methods:Three cases diagnosed with stenosis or premature closure of fetal ductus arteriosus in Peking University First Hospital between January 2022 and June 2022 were retrospectively enrolled. Clinical features and perinatal management strategies were summarized.Results:Fetal cardiac abnormalities (right heart enlargement and tricuspid regurgitation) were detected in the three cases by routine prenatal ultrasound at the gestational weeks of 24, 30 and 23, respectively. Fetal echocardiography confirmed the diagnosis of stenosis or premature closure of fetal ductus arteriosus and no other structural anomalies were detected. All three pregnant women denied taking non-steroidal anti-inflammatory drugs. Case 1 and case 2 underwent emergency cesarean section due to suspected fetal cardiac dysfunction with a cardiovascular profile score of 6 and 5. The two neonates were transferred to the neonatal intensive care unit and discharged with good prognosis (normal cardiac function) on the 56th and 42nd day after birth. During a close monitoring, the stenosis of fetal ductus arteriosus improved in case 3 and a full-term neonate was delivered at 38 weeks by elective cesarean section because of a history of cesarean section.Conclusions:In the second and third trimesters of pregnancy, attention should be drawn to the fetal ductus arteriosus during ultrasound imaging, especially when right heart enlargement and tricuspid regurgitation were detected. For fetuses with suspected ductus arteriosus stenosis, a close monitor of the ductus arteriosus and the ultrasound findings indicating cardiac dysfunction is needed and the cardiovascular profile score should also be involved. Fetuses with premature closure of the ductus arteriosus should be delivered promptly and the postnatal cardiac outcomes are good.

ABSTRACT

Cerebral microbleeds (CMBs) are an imaging biomarker of cerebral small vessel disease (CSVD). Researches have shown that CMBs are a risk factor for hemorrhagic transformation and poor outcomes after reperfusion therapy in patients with acute ischemic stroke. This article reviews the relationship between CMBs and the outcomes of reperfusion therapy in patients with acute ischemic stroke.

ABSTRACT

Objective:To investigate and analyse the current status of screening and management of diabetic kidney disease (DKD) in six provinces and cities in China.Methods:The qualitative research method of focus group interview was adopted, based on the semi-structured interview outline, the clinical medical and disease control personnel in Tianjin, Chongqing, Gansu, Hubei, Heilongjiang, and Guangdong were interviewed. The interview transcripts were analyzed using thematic analysis, and MAXQDA analysis software was used for data management and analysis.Results:A total of 6 interviews were conducted with 49 interviewees. Forty respondents (81.6%) claimed that DKD screening was critical; 53.1% think that it was not easy for patients to obtain DKD screening services; 40.8%, 26.5% and 14.3% of the people believed that the technology of DKD screening services was moderate, simple or very simple, respectively. Of the respondents,16.3% thought that the cost of DKD screening service was relatively expensive, while 83.7% thought that the cost was inexpensive; 75.5% of the respondents believed that the patients could receive early DKD screening service. The factors of fully implementing medical reform policies, changing concepts and actively serving patients, and integrating external resources in medical and health institutions at all levels and of all types were conducive to the development of DKD screening and management services. The lack of technology and personnel for DKD screening services at the grassroots level, the lack of trust in the service capabilities of grassroots medical institutions by patients, the low level of patient awareness, and the novel coronavirus infection epidemic had an adverse impact on the development of DKD screening and management services.Conclusion:The screening and management services for DKD are relatively limited in China, and there is a significant fragmentation in the management and care of diabetes and DKD.
